Company will produce team-branded versions of its patented sneaker cleaning wipe
October 14, 2025
By: Tara Olivo
Associate Editor at Nonwovens Industry
Game Face Grooming, the men’s care innovator behind the industry’s first push-activated, sneaker-cleaning wipe, announced that it has secured a multi-year, all-30-team licensing agreement with the NBALAB, a sublicensing partner of the National Basketball Association (NBA). The deal grants Game Face Grooming rights to produce and sell team-branded versions of its patented Push-Hold-Unfold sneaker cleaning wipe pods throughout the U.S. and Canada. The first wave launches with six iconic franchises: Philadelphia 76ers, New York Knicks, Boston Celtics, Los Angeles Lakers, Golden State Warriors and Chicago Bulls. Additional teams, including the Oklahoma City Thunder, Dallas Mavericks, Minnesota Timberwolves, San Antonio Spurs, Miami Heat, Houston Rockets and the Los Angeles Clippers, will follow in phased waves throughout the 2025-26 NBA regular season. “We wanted to redefine how clean travels, and your kicks don’t get timeouts, neither should your confidence to clean them on-the-go,” says Philip Williams, founder and CEO, Game Face Grooming. “By keeping our natural non-toxic cleaning solution sealed inside each pod until the very moment you activate it, we lock in freshness and dramatically extend shelf life with no leaks, no evaporation, just pure cleaning power on demand.” Made with a biodegradable and compostable plant-based cloth that breaks down naturally, the wipes feature a patented delivery system in four simple steps: press the pod, wait for the wipe to soak up the solution, unfold and clean. The solution remains sealed apart from the wipe until activation, preventing evaporation and preserving efficacy for years on the shelf. Additionally, the non-toxic, alcohol-free formula is safe on every colorway and on leather, suede, canvas, mesh, synthetics, plus golf shoes, gym bags, backpacks, hats, purses and more. “NBALAB seeks partners who fuse true innovation with hoops culture,” adds Eric Perugini, president of NBALAB. “Game Face Grooming’s innovative wipe technology lets fans protect their sneaker investments with the same passion they bring to the game, now across every team in the league.” NBA-branded Game Face Sneaker Cleaning Wipes will be available for purchase this October on their website gamefacegrooming.com. MSRP: $15 (8-count box)
